Handover Note — Logistics Transition

To the sales leads: as of next month we move from Carthan Freight to Milrow Logistics for all outbound shipments from the Denfield hub. Expect a two-week overlap period; quote standard delivery windows as unchanged. Escalate any client concerns to operations, not the carrier. Outgoing and incoming directors have aligned on the broader direction, noted below.

board note of bawep-tajef: Queniusek Systems plans to raise the Quenvan list price by 53.1 percent in March. The pricing group signed off on a budget of $176.4 million for Project Drueth. The renewal with Casionix Partners closes at $142.5 million a year, 8.3 percent below the last contract. Project Fraax slips by six weeks because of the tooling delay.

Welcome to Spoolhawk, our printer-spooler microservice. Reviews mostly focus on the queue-drain logic in worker.go, so start there. Local runs need the broker URL and the spool bucket name in your .env before anything boots. One more thing: the spooler won't authenticate to the Inkwell relay without its signing secret, so add this line to your .env first.

env line for yahog-hawef: LEDGER_TOKEN29=f3e084b62fec33273cce43d93633f

Subject: Tracing setup for the Quillbrook integration

Hi, and welcome aboard. As you wire your services into the Quillbrook mesh, please propagate our trace header on every outbound call, including retries — dropped headers are the main reason spans appear orphaned in the Lanternview dashboard. Sampling is set to 20% in staging, so don't panic if some requests vanish. To query the trace API directly while you're validating your integration, authenticate with the token below.

login token, yagaf-hawip: eyJhbGciOiJIUzI1NiIsInR5cCI6IkpXVCJ9.eyJzdWIiOiIdHjlcNIn0.AFyH-u9q

## Formula sandbox tuning

User-supplied formulas in Gridmoor execute inside a restricted interpreter with hard ceilings on time, memory, and call depth. Reviewers should confirm any change to these ceilings is justified in the PR description, since raising them widens the abuse surface. Defaults were chosen from production traces. The current limits are as follows.

limits module of tafog-fawip:
WEIGHTS = {
    "julix": 57,
    "lamys": 992,
    "kasvan": 209,
    "quenok": 750,
    "alddor": 259,
    "oliath": 1009,
    "wenix": 815,
}